Resumen de Bottom Sediment Analysis at Lhok Seudu Beach, Aceh Besar

Ichsan Setiawan, Yopi Ilhamsyah, Muhammad Wildan Gunarya, Muhammad Ridha Ihsan, Syarifah Meurah Yuni

  • The research with the title Basic Sediment Analysis of Lhok Seudu Beach, Aceh Besar was conducted from March to April 2023. Lhok Seudu Beach is a bay beach in the area affected by the 2004 tsunami. This study aims to determine the characteristics of sediments as a basis for geological oceanography studies. The method used serves to analyze the shape of the bottom sediment with granulometric analysis. Granulometric analysis itself uses the sieve analysis method or multilevel screening to determine the results. The results of this study are the largest mean sediment of each station in each grain size is the type of medium sand with an average percentage of 0.2794029% and the smallest mean is the type of coarse silt with an average percentage of 0.05309625%. The conclusion obtained in this study is the divergence of the sediment in each station. The conclusion obtained in this study is that the differential found at EBA and WBA is influenced by topography and sediment transportation on sediment characteristics.
